Web2 days ago · In 2024, the Philippines received $2.8 billion worth of Special Drawing Rights (SDRs) from the IMF, as part of the latter’s efforts to help countries recover from the coronavirus pandemic. Member countries were allocated SDRs — the fund’s unit of exchange backed by dollars, euros, yen, sterling and yuan — in proportion to their quota ...

WebThe IMF treated the Asian financial crisis like other situations where countries could not meet their balance of payment obligations.
